General Information

Title: Comfort, O Lord, the soul of Thy servant
Composer: William Crotch
Source of text: Psalm 86 v. 4 (Book of Common Prayer)

Number of voices: 4vv   Voicing: SATB
Genre: SacredAnthem

Language: English
Instruments: Organ

First published: 1905 in The Anthem Book, no. 43
    2nd published: 1933 in The Church Anthem Book, p. 21
